From: Robert Haas <rhaas@postgresql.org>
Date: Thu, 9 Feb 2017 16:42:51 -0500
Subject: [PATCH] Rename command line options for ongoing xlog -> wal
 conversion.

initdb and pg_basebackup now have a --waldir option rather --xlogdir,
and pg_basebackup now has --wal-method rather than --xlog-method.
